Re: MOTOR TORPEDO BOATS ww2
« Reply #1 on: June 12, 2021, 09:38:22 am »

Italeri do a 1/35 scale range of various MTB designs such as the Vosper 71ft MTB, Elco or Higgins 80ft MTB, and German S-Boat. They are easy to convert to radio control and have removable decks held in place with screws. Good detail and plenty of opportunities to convert.

Does any one know which is the best model kit to buy, I want a scale 1/32 if possible, chet
Lindberg do a 1/32 PT-109 model that is designed for motorising - some versions of the kit don't come with the motor.     It's not the most accurate of models but it's big enough to do whatever you need.    It's significantly bigger than the Italeri 1/35 scale so it's got much more displacement making fitting out dead simple.      The actual plastic of the kit is less fragile than the Italeri kits so it's more robust.

I'd put proper motors and propshafts in it - the kit ones are a bit rubbish.
My second one had twin 540 brushed motors with 4mm shafts and brass rudders - twin ESC with a mixer function.     The model has a huge hatch in the top for internal access. - it's a doddle to get on the water.
